一区二区三区三上|欧美在线视频五区|国产午夜无码在线观看视频|亚洲国产裸体网站|无码成年人影视|亚洲AV亚洲AV|成人开心激情五月|欧美性爱内射视频|超碰人人干人人上|一区二区无码三区亚洲人区久久精品

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

基于PREEvision的SOA設(shè)計—功能亮點

Vector維克多 ? 來源:Vector維克多 ? 2022-12-26 11:55 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

SOA 的功能特性

Part.1PREEvision介紹

1. 應(yīng)用領(lǐng)域

PREEvision是汽車行業(yè)的分布式系統(tǒng)開發(fā)工具,主要面向需求工程、AUTOSAR系統(tǒng)、軟硬件設(shè)計以及線束開發(fā),覆蓋電子電氣設(shè)計全流程。

PREEvision依托于模型開發(fā)方式,提供多人協(xié)同的工作環(huán)境,支持系統(tǒng)元素的抽象、分解和復(fù)用;對于多平臺復(fù)雜車型的設(shè)計過程,提供變型管理、一致性校驗、動態(tài)評估一系列解決方案,有助于幫助工程師提前發(fā)現(xiàn)設(shè)計缺陷,縮短車型開發(fā)周期。

4f3705bc-84d0-11ed-bfe3-dac502259ad0.png

2.AUTOSAR SOA 系統(tǒng)設(shè)計

針對AUTOSAR SOA系統(tǒng)設(shè)計,支持AUTOSAR Classic和AUTOSAR Adaptive系統(tǒng)混合設(shè)計流程,并具有以下設(shè)計優(yōu)勢:

AUTOSAR Classic系統(tǒng)支持導(dǎo)入和導(dǎo)出AUTOSAR 4.X,AUTOSAR Adaptive系統(tǒng)支持導(dǎo)入和導(dǎo)出AUTOSAR 19-03

支持AUTOSAR系統(tǒng)的一致性校驗工作

PREEvision作為AUTOSAR工具鏈中關(guān)鍵環(huán)節(jié),能夠和CANoe以及DaVinci工具相互配合工作

Part.2SOA AUTOSAR Classic Platform 設(shè)計流程

1. 服務(wù)定義

PREEvision支持以功能設(shè)計為導(dǎo)向的設(shè)計和以服務(wù)為導(dǎo)向的設(shè)計流程,PREEvision提供SOA Diagram來展示服務(wù)和服務(wù)接口

4f654b7a-84d0-11ed-bfe3-dac502259ad0.png

4faf1322-84d0-11ed-bfe3-dac502259ad0.png

2. 服務(wù)接口定義

基于PREEvision,可以對服務(wù)接口進行設(shè)計,包含Method、FF Method、Event及Field,工具能夠自動將服務(wù)及服務(wù)接口轉(zhuǎn)換為SWC Type及相關(guān)軟件層Interface。依托于服務(wù)部署,服務(wù)接口最終實現(xiàn)為ECU間通信的通信信號。

4fce3c5c-84d0-11ed-bfe3-dac502259ad0.png

500538b0-84d0-11ed-bfe3-dac502259ad0.png

3.數(shù)字類型定義及分配

AUTOSAR 4.X支持Application data types、Implementation data types和Base data types

Application data types

從應(yīng)用的角度來定義數(shù)據(jù)類型,支持虛擬總線(Virtual Functional Bus)上SWC的通信。

Implementation data types

從實現(xiàn)的角度來定義數(shù)據(jù)類型,最終落實到編程語言上(如C語言),用于下游基礎(chǔ)軟件中接口信息的交互。

Base data types

定義與硬件平臺相關(guān)的數(shù)據(jù)類型,在下游生成RTE相關(guān)數(shù)據(jù)屬性。

PREEvision支持設(shè)計以上數(shù)據(jù)類型的定義,并支持將數(shù)據(jù)類型分配給服務(wù)接口

503d7284-84d0-11ed-bfe3-dac502259ad0.png

4. 網(wǎng)絡(luò)拓撲定義

PREEvision中基于Network Diagram來定義CAN、CAN FD、LIN、FlexRay及Ethernet Cluster。在以太網(wǎng)傳輸過程中,可以定義內(nèi)部或者外部Switch連接,通過網(wǎng)關(guān)可以連接不同的傳輸協(xié)議。

5061ab18-84d0-11ed-bfe3-dac502259ad0.png

508b1a8e-84d0-11ed-bfe3-dac502259ad0.png

5. 服務(wù)部署及信號路由

通過服務(wù)部署,將服務(wù)部署給不同的ECU節(jié)點,并通過信號路由功能,將服務(wù)接口數(shù)據(jù)生成為ECU間節(jié)點通信信號。

50a876ce-84d0-11ed-bfe3-dac502259ad0.png

50cf99e8-84d0-11ed-bfe3-dac502259ad0.png

6. 序列化

信號在傳輸過程中,首先需要在發(fā)送端進行序列化,在接收端進行反序列化操作,序列化能夠?qū)?fù)雜數(shù)據(jù)類型變成字節(jié)流的形式,在總線上進行傳輸。PREEvision支持不同類型Transformer的定義,以保證設(shè)計的完整性。

50f007fa-84d0-11ed-bfe3-dac502259ad0.png

在信號傳輸過程中,信號可以基于Com或者LdCom進行傳輸,PREEvision可以根據(jù)需求進行靈活配置,并且提供自動校驗功能,對不滿足LdCom的信號進行校驗。

510c9e38-84d0-11ed-bfe3-dac502259ad0.png

PREEvision提供AUTOSAR上千種一致性檢查功能,對不滿足LdCom的信號進行Check:

512d5de4-84d0-11ed-bfe3-dac502259ad0.png

7. Socket Adaptor設(shè)計

以太網(wǎng)底層基于Socket進行傳輸,Socket Adaptor模塊能夠?qū)⑸嫌位赑DU的傳輸轉(zhuǎn)換為基于Socket的傳輸。PREEvision支持自定義配置Socket,用戶可以根據(jù)IP地址及端口號,修改Socket相關(guān)參數(shù)。

514a2dd4-84d0-11ed-bfe3-dac502259ad0.png

8. Service Discovery設(shè)計

通過Service Discovery,客戶端能夠獲取到服務(wù)端所提供的服務(wù),PREEvision工具支持Service Discovery結(jié)構(gòu)自動生成。

517de94e-84d0-11ed-bfe3-dac502259ad0.png

9. 系統(tǒng)校驗

PREEvision提供AUTOSAR規(guī)則校驗,保證設(shè)計內(nèi)容的完整性,用戶可以根據(jù)需求,自行選擇對應(yīng)的校驗規(guī)則,對設(shè)計內(nèi)容進行校驗:

519d2ae8-84d0-11ed-bfe3-dac502259ad0.png

10. 導(dǎo)出ARXML文件

當(dāng)設(shè)計完成后,用戶可以根據(jù)需求,在軟件層或者部件層導(dǎo)出對應(yīng)的ARXML文件,在導(dǎo)出ARXML文件時,依據(jù)下游工具需求,可以導(dǎo)出不同ARXML版本。

524275ca-84d0-11ed-bfe3-dac502259ad0.png

審核編輯:湯梓紅

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 接口
    +關(guān)注

    關(guān)注

    33

    文章

    8990

    瀏覽量

    153639
  • AUTOSAR
    +關(guān)注

    關(guān)注

    10

    文章

    378

    瀏覽量

    22610
  • SOA
    SOA
    +關(guān)注

    關(guān)注

    1

    文章

    301

    瀏覽量

    28172

原文標(biāo)題:基于PREEvision的SOA設(shè)計—功能亮點

文章出處:【微信號:VectorChina,微信公眾號:Vector維克多】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點推薦

    Vector PREEvision 10.19支持AUTOSAR 24-11版本

    ,建模過程更加高效。結(jié)合自動布局功能,可快速創(chuàng)建有效圖形。 PREEvision的演示模型展示了如何借助技術(shù)示例開發(fā)復(fù)雜系統(tǒng)的結(jié)構(gòu)與行為。
    的頭像 發(fā)表于 06-14 11:47 ?434次閱讀

    OptiSystem應(yīng)用:寬帶SOA特性

    本案例的目的是通過仿真表征半導(dǎo)體光放大器(SOA)。 首先,我們將描述SOA對輸入信號功率變化的響應(yīng)。 圖1顯示了仿真中使用的系統(tǒng)布局。將連續(xù)激光器的功率參數(shù)置于掃描模式下,在-40 ~ 10
    發(fā)表于 06-10 08:45

    Vector發(fā)布PREEvision 10.18版本

    新版PREEvision提供許多優(yōu)化,幫助工程師跟蹤開發(fā)項目,并快速找到做出決策所需的詳細信息。
    的頭像 發(fā)表于 05-27 09:38 ?268次閱讀

    OptiSystem應(yīng)用:SOA波長變換器(XGM)

    本案例演示了SOA作為使用交叉增益飽和效應(yīng)(XGM)的波長變換器的應(yīng)用。 波長為λ1的光信號與需要轉(zhuǎn)換為波長為λ2的連續(xù)光信號同時輸入SOA,SOA對λ1光功率存在增益飽和特性,結(jié)果使得輸入光信號所
    發(fā)表于 05-20 08:46

    OptiSystem應(yīng)用:寬帶SOA特性

    本案例的目的是通過仿真表征半導(dǎo)體光放大器(SOA)。 首先,我們將描述SOA對輸入信號功率變化的響應(yīng)。 圖1顯示了仿真中使用的系統(tǒng)布局。將連續(xù)激光器的功率參數(shù)置于掃描模式下,在-40 ~ 10
    發(fā)表于 05-19 08:48

    【見合課堂】SOA的光放大功能

    SOA
    天津見合八方光電科技有限公司
    發(fā)布于 :2025年04月18日 13:57:36

    SOA架構(gòu)開發(fā)小助手PAVELINK.SOA-Converter 2.1.2新版本發(fā)布

    為提升汽車SOA架構(gòu)設(shè)計開發(fā)效率,優(yōu)化用戶體驗,我們對PAVELINK.SOA-Converter進行了全新升級。本次2.1.2新版本升級,聚焦于提升軟件性能、擴展功能特性及增強用戶交互體驗。
    的頭像 發(fā)表于 04-09 10:37 ?941次閱讀
    <b class='flag-5'>SOA</b>架構(gòu)開發(fā)小助手PAVELINK.<b class='flag-5'>SOA</b>-Converter 2.1.2新版本發(fā)布

    OptiSystem應(yīng)用:SOA波長變換器(XGM)

    本案例演示了SOA作為使用交叉增益飽和效應(yīng)(XGM)的波長變換器的應(yīng)用。 波長為λ1的光信號與需要轉(zhuǎn)換為波長為λ2的連續(xù)光信號同時輸入SOA,SOA對λ1光功率存在增益飽和特性,結(jié)果使得輸入光信號所
    發(fā)表于 04-01 09:35

    PREEvision插件使用場景介紹

    PREEvision插件中心(Add-in House)是Vector中國PREEvision團隊針對中國用戶開發(fā)的插件網(wǎng)站。用戶可以在這里找到各種場景的擴展插件,包括以太網(wǎng)與SOA設(shè)計、軟件及通信設(shè)計、硬件設(shè)計、變更管理等領(lǐng)域
    的頭像 發(fā)表于 03-14 13:50 ?519次閱讀
    <b class='flag-5'>PREEvision</b>插件使用場景介紹

    淺談PREEvision 10.17版本的新增功能

    新版PREEvision支持使用時序圖行為建模,將系統(tǒng)工程的所有核心概念整合到一個工具中。
    的頭像 發(fā)表于 03-06 15:25 ?456次閱讀
    淺談<b class='flag-5'>PREEvision</b> 10.17版本的新增<b class='flag-5'>功能</b>

    OptiSystem應(yīng)用:寬帶SOA特性

    本案例的目的是通過仿真表征半導(dǎo)體光放大器(SOA)。 首先,我們將描述SOA對輸入信號功率變化的響應(yīng)。 圖1顯示了仿真中使用的系統(tǒng)布局。將連續(xù)激光器的功率參數(shù)置于掃描模式下,在-40 ~ 10
    發(fā)表于 02-05 09:29

    OptiSystem應(yīng)用:SOA波長變換器(XGM)

    本案例演示了SOA作為使用交叉增益飽和效應(yīng)(XGM)的波長變換器的應(yīng)用。 波長為λ1的光信號與需要轉(zhuǎn)換為波長為λ2的連續(xù)光信號同時輸入SOA,SOA對λ1光功率存在增益飽和特性,結(jié)果使得輸入光信號所
    發(fā)表于 01-06 08:51

    分布式、域控及SOA架構(gòu)車身功能測試方案

    北匯信息推出分布式、域控以及SOA架構(gòu)的車身功能測試解決方案,支持在實驗室環(huán)境下完成車身單部件、系統(tǒng)級功能自動化測試,可以極大地提升車身功能的可靠性和穩(wěn)定性。
    的頭像 發(fā)表于 12-27 09:05 ?2674次閱讀
    分布式、域控及<b class='flag-5'>SOA</b>架構(gòu)車身<b class='flag-5'>功能</b>測試方案

    SOA光脈沖調(diào)制模塊簡介

    SOA(半導(dǎo)體光放大器)光脈沖調(diào)制模塊使用半導(dǎo)體光放大器(SOA作為調(diào)制器時也稱為SOM)作為核心器件,利用半導(dǎo)體光放大器SOA的高速調(diào)制特性,通過SMA接口接入的外部觸發(fā)的窄脈沖調(diào)制電信號,或使用內(nèi)部觸發(fā)模式通過內(nèi)部驅(qū)動電路對
    的頭像 發(fā)表于 11-20 10:38 ?1210次閱讀
    <b class='flag-5'>SOA</b>光脈沖調(diào)制模塊簡介

    SOA架構(gòu)開發(fā)小助手PAVELINK.SOA-Converter V1.4.2新版本發(fā)布

    PAVELINK.SOA-Converter轉(zhuǎn)換工具,用于銜接基于SOA的控制器設(shè)計、開發(fā)及測試過程中所常見的各類軟件工具。PAVELINK.SOA-Converter能提供IDL及服務(wù)矩陣等文件
    的頭像 發(fā)表于 08-07 15:10 ?799次閱讀
    <b class='flag-5'>SOA</b>架構(gòu)開發(fā)小助手PAVELINK.<b class='flag-5'>SOA</b>-Converter V1.4.2新版本發(fā)布